Visa officers need more than just your word on your arrival and departure dates. They want proof that you\u2019re not planning an indefinite stay. The temporary hotel booking for visa purposes acts as concrete evidence that you have arranged accommodation during your travel.<\/p>\n

Take the Schengen zone \u2014 the 26 European countries with a shared visa system. They require proof of lodging for visa issuance. The European Union Immigration Portal lists acceptable documents including hotel bookings, invitation letters from hosts, or other lodging proof. The U.S., Canada, Australia, and many other countries have similar requirements. They want to see confirmed or reasonable accommodation plans before approving your visa.<\/p>\n

The \u201ctemporary\u201d aspect is crucial because no traveler wants to pay hundreds of dollars for hotels without visa confirmation. Temporary bookings let you reserve a room without paying upfront or committing long-term. You present this provisional reservation to the embassy, then cancel it later if needed. In 2026, with tighter travel controls and more demand, this \u201creserve first, pay later\u201d approach is both practical and necessary.<\/p>\n

In essence, a temporary hotel booking for visa purposes proves you have a place to stay without spending money you might lose or becoming locked into inflexible plans.<\/p>\n

Booking this type of reservation effectively requires some strategy to meet embassy standards and avoid financial risk. Follow these six proven steps:<\/p>\n

    \n
  1. Choose hotels or services with free cancellation policies<\/strong>
    This is essential if your visa is delayed or your plans change. Without free cancellation, you risk losing your deposit or full payment.<\/li>\n
  2. Ensure your booking matches visa application dates exactly<\/strong>
    If your visa states travel dates from July 10 to July 20 in Paris, your booking must reflect those exact dates. Any mismatch might raise doubts.<\/li>\n
  3. Obtain a formal booking confirmation<\/strong>
    Embassies usually require an official document including your name, stay dates, hotel address, and contact information. A casual email or screenshot often won\u2019t suffice.<\/li>\n
  4. Avoid upfront payments where possible<\/strong>
